If you enter as amateur, you'll get a listing/CD of source music so you're not going out there cold. Amateur is defined as an intermediate level dancer with some performance experience who does not regularly earn money from teaching or performing with the exclusion of tips or meals or monies won at competitions.

As a matter of fact, this was one of my favorites, if not THE favorite that I have ever done, and I've competed all over the country in about 15 different competitions! It's great! I like it so much because it was stress-free! I didn't have to worry about choreography or even the music. We didn't know what was going to play when we got up there (sounds scary, but not really - more like freeing) and we didn't know what our bodies were going to do. So it was "in the moment". The art of improvisation is slowly becoming a dying art in belly dance - this contest is all about improvisation - the way belly dance is supposed to be performed in its truest essence!
